Tweaking Projections Again – Aroldis Chapman to Close

The Reds announced today that Aroldis Chapman will remain at closer, rather than join the starting rotation.
So I’ve updated the RotoValue projections with his new role, now giving the Reds’ saves to him instead of Jonathan Broxton. So Broxton’s value plummets, while Chapman’s becomes more reliably solid. While he already projected to be a rather valuable starter by most systems I had, he likely has less risk of injury or underperformance in the bullpen. Chapman’s value might not rise all that much, but Broxton’s surely takes a hit, so take notice for those drafting this weekend!
